We discovered a charming local coffee shop/restaurant on a Sunday drive to Barnet high street, seeking a change from the usual coffee chains and hoping to support a small business. The front window of the restaurant was attractive, featuring a delicious array of pastries and sandwiches that immediately caught our eye. The large windows allowed plenty of natural light to flood the space, and the rustic decor added to the welcoming atmosphere.
On a quiet Sunday morning, there were many available tables, though the restaurant did get busier as we enjoyed our breakfast. The interior was spacious and warm, but the only drawback was the harsh acoustics that made every sound echo throughout the space. However, the absence of background music made for a pleasant environment.
The menu offered an excellent selection of breakfast and brunch items, including traditional breakfast fare, shakshuka, various paninis and sandwiches, and a tempting array of sweet treats. The prices were somewhat high, which may deter some customers.
The service was efficient and friendly, and all requests were quickly taken care of. Although we had initially only planned on getting coffee, we couldn't resist trying a panini and almond croissant, both of which were fresh and delicious.
Overall, we had a positive experience and would definitely recommend this lovely local coffee shop/restaurant.

Fabulously retro French in style with a convincing selection of patisseries, bread and hot food with the darkest roast to be found locally; enough to pretend you are en Francaise enjoying an “expresso” rather than an espresso, particularly if you can block out the din of English conversations. Furthering your delusion, most of the team speak French if you feel the need to practice your skills while you enjoy a drink, cake or more.

The crown jewel of my visit was undoubtedly the Salted Caramel Mille-Feuille. Each bite of this beautifully crafted pastry was a symphony of textures and flavors. The caramel had just the right balance of sweetness and saltiness, while the layers of flaky puff pastry added a deliciously satisfying crunch. It's clear that the patisserie's craftsmen have perfected this delicate balance with utmost precision.
In addition to the Mille-Feuille, the bakery's assortment of other pastries is equally delectable, showcasing an impressive variety of treats from traditional classics to unique creations.
The small size of Patisserie Joie De Vie is a charming element, lending the bakery an air of coziness and intimacy. However, it does mean limited seating. During peak hours, you might find yourself waiting for a spot or choosing to enjoy your pastry elsewhere.
Customer service at the patisserie is generally commendable. The staff, while busy, are friendly and attentive, ready with suggestions if you're unsure of what to choose from their extensive menu.
The ambiance in Patisserie Joie De Vie is welcoming, with a blend of rustic and modern aesthetics. However, given the bakery's popularity, the atmosphere can occasionally feel a bit crowded due to its size.
